Monday Morning Photo - Plaza Mayor, Salamanca

One of the most beautiful squares in Spain the Plaza Mayor, a baroque style plaza, on the north side is the City Hall building. Decorated with stonework medallions between each arch, including depictions of  Carlos I, Alfonso XI, Fernando VI, Cervantes and Santa Teresa. The buildings are three storeys, supported by semicircular arches topped by a balustrade.  Plaza Mayor, Salamanca See my One Day in Salamanca - What Not to Miss post on Luxury Spain Travel. Monday Morning Photo - Gruta de las Maravillas, Aracena, Huelva

The stunning, living, ever-changing beautiful caves or grotto  - Gruta de  las Maravillas in Aracena is  multi-levelled with various chambers of incredible beauty and awesome formations first discovered in the XIX century and opened to the public, as Spain's first tourist cave, in 1914.
